Output d57a29c8b76d7218abd460721915e50b76812057c707bde6f601180fcb26cf00:1

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985a1e1e8bfd936d23a4403915942e1840340a21 OP_EQUAL
address
3FaabBm3D6dKV7HxBzrQGLFepdLzNFWsDC
transaction
d57a29c8b76d7218abd460721915e50b76812057c707bde6f601180fcb26cf00
spent
true